Detailed Description

template<unsigned int dim>
class ConcSourcesBdrAssemblyConvection< dim >

Auxiliary container class for Finite element and related objects of given dimension.

Assembles concentration sources for each substance and set boundary conditions. note: the source of concentration is multiplied by time interval (gives the mass, not the flow like before)
